Overview
This permanent full‑time position is based within the Occupational Therapy Department at the Vale of Leven Hospital and the Dumbarton Joint Hospital. The role supports older peoples mental health services in West Dunbartonshire.

Responsibilities
* Conduct occupational therapy assessments and deliver a range of therapeutic, occupation‑focused interventions.
* Evaluate the effectiveness of treatment, adapt interventions accordingly and work closely with nursing, psychology and support worker staff.
* Supervise occupational therapy support staff and provide regular supervision.
* Communicate effectively with other disciplines, relatives, carers and partner organisations.
Qualifications & Skills
* Registered Occupational Therapist (BSc/PGDip/PGCert) with a strong clinical foundation.
* Excellent communication skills and the ability to work collaboratively across multidisciplinary teams.
* Evidence‑based practice and commitment to continuous professional development.
